Paddy Pimblett notched his ninth straight win at UFC 314, and it wasn’t pretty for Michael Chandler.
The UFC’s No. 12-ranked lightweight bodied, bloodied and battered his opponent in Miami on Saturday, ending the fight with a third-round stoppage for the most impressive win of his MMA career.
The first round was somewhat even, with Pimblett landing hard leg kicks and Chandler taking control for a while after a nice takedown on a counter, but it was pure abuse by Pimblett after the first five minutes. Pimblett was in control standing up and on the ground throughout the second round, which former UFC champ Henry Cejudo called the best of his career.

The third round was even better for Pimblett, and worse for Chandler. He opened a huge cut on Chandler’s face early in the frame, and was chasing him around the Octagon until the fight’s merciful ending.
